Dear baobab

Author: Cheryl Foggo; Qin Leng
Publisher: Toronto : Second Story Press, ©2011.
Edition/Format:   Book : Fiction : Juvenile audience : English
Summary:
After his parents die, seven-year-old Maiko leaves his village in Africa to live across the ocean with his aunt and uncle. When he thinks of home, he thinks of the big baobab tree at the center of the village. In his new home, Maiko feels a special connection to the small spruce tree in the front yard, especially when he finds out it is the same age as he is.
